Factors Influencing Edging Strip Prices
Several factors contribute to the variation in pricing of wood door edging strips:
Material: The type of wood used for the edging strip significantly impacts its cost. Common materials include fir, pine, and oak, with oak being the most expensive.
Dimensions: Longer and wider strips require more material and labor, resulting in a higher price.
Profile: The shape or profile of the edging strip, such as "T-molding" or "Ogee," can affect its cost.
Finish: Edging strips can be painted, stained, or left unfinished. Finishing adds an extra cost.
Quantity: Bulk orders typically qualify for discounts.
Manufacturer: Different manufacturers have varying production costs and pricing strategies.

Price Comparison and Market Analysis
By comparing prices from multiple manufacturers and analyzing market trends, we strive to provide competitive and reasonable pricing for our edging strips. Here's an approximate price range for our popular products:
Fir T-molding (1-inch wide, 8-foot length): $0.50-$0.80 per foot
Pine Ogee molding (1.5-inch wide, 8-foot length): $0.70-$1.00 per foot
Oak Bullnose molding (2-inch wide, 8-foot length): $1.00-$1.20 per foot

FAQs About Edging Strip Pricing
Why are oak edging strips more expensive than other materials? Oak is a premium wood known for its durability, beauty, and longevity.
How can I save money on edging strips without compromising quality? Order in bulk, consider fir or pine instead of oak, and opt for unfinished strips that you can paint or stain yourself.
